In 1858, Emily Camp entered the world in Shute, Devon, England, United Kingdom, born to Job Phippen And Charlotte Phippen. In 1921, Emily Camp was employed in Clearwell, Gloucestershire, England, United Kingdo. Emily Camp married Robert Camp, and had children including Florence Mary Camp, Robert Camp. Emily Camp passed away in 1942 in Gloucester, Gloucestershire, England, United Kingdom.
